1. The Evolution of Customs Risk Management
The traditional approach to customs risk management often focused on manual processes and rule-based systems. However, the rise of digital technologies has transformed how risks are identified, assessed, and mitigated. One of the key trends is the integration of advanced analytics and artificial intelligence (AI) into customs operations. AI can process vast amounts of data in real-time, enabling customs authorities to detect anomalies and suspicious activities more efficiently. This not only enhances compliance but also streamlines the clearance process, reducing delays and improving overall efficiency.
2. Innovations in Security and Compliance
In the wake of global security concerns and increased regulatory scrutiny, customs authorities are adopting more sophisticated methods to ensure compliance and security. Blockchain technology is gaining traction as a solution for enhancing transparency and traceability in supply chains. By using blockchain, customs officials can verify the authenticity and integrity of goods more effectively, reducing the risk of fraudulent activities. Another innovative approach is the use of Internet of Things (IoT) devices to monitor goods in transit. These devices can provide real-time tracking and condition monitoring, helping to prevent theft, tampering, and other forms of non-compliance.
3. Future Developments and Emerging Technologies
Looking ahead, the future of customs risk management is likely to be defined by emerging technologies and strategic partnerships. Quantum computing, for instance, could revolutionize how customs authorities analyze large datasets and solve complex problems. Its potential to process data at an unprecedented speed and scale could lead to more accurate risk assessments and better resource allocation. Additionally, the increasing importance of sustainability and environmental considerations is driving the integration of green customs practices. This includes the use of eco-friendly packaging materials, energy-efficient customs infrastructure, and sustainable supply chain management.
4. Skills and Expertise in the Future Workforce
As customs risk management evolves, so too do the skills required to excel in this field. The future workforce will need a blend of technical, analytical, and strategic skills. Proficiency in data analytics, cybersecurity, and AI is becoming increasingly important. Moreover, a deep understanding of international trade laws and regulations, as well as cultural and geopolitical factors, will be crucial. Soft skills such as communication, collaboration, and leadership will also be essential, as professionals will need to work across different departments and with various stakeholders to drive effective risk management strategies.
